How to water lucky bamboo

How to water lucky bamboo

1. Watering method during hydroponics

1. When growing it hydroponically, the most important task is to change the water. Usually you need to change the water every once in a while. When the temperature is too high, that is, in spring and summer, it grows very fast and you need to change the water more frequently. The best time is once every 3 to 5 days. Then in winter, the temperature is lower and its growth becomes slow. At this time, you can extend the water change time appropriately, with once every 10 days being the best.

2. Although you need to change the water frequently during hydroponics, it also depends on the specific time. If it is in the rooting stage, it is not suitable to change the water at this time. You should add appropriate water after the water evaporates.

3. It likes rotten water very much. If it has grown roots during hydroponics, you should reduce the number of times you change the water. If you change the water too frequently, it will affect the roots' ability to absorb nutrients and make the leaves turn yellow.

2. Watering method during soil cultivation

1. It likes moist places, so during the growing season, the soil must be kept moist at all times and the air humidity should also be higher.

2. In spring and autumn, the soil in the pot should be kept properly moist. Watering can be done according to the actual situation of the soil in the pot. In summer, not only should the soil be moistened, but water should also be sprayed around the pot to increase the humidity of the air. In winter, because the temperature is lower, its growth slows down, so watering should be restrained at this time. The soil should not be too wet. In addition, when watering, pay attention to the temperature to prevent frost damage to the roots.
